Saints
- Holy and Wonderworking Unmercenaries Cosmas and Damian, brothers (284)
- Holy 2000 Martyrs, by the sword.
- Holy 25 Martyrs in Nicomedia, by fire.
- Saint Maurice.
- Venerable Peter the Patrician (Peter of Constantinople), monk (854)
- Venerable Basil, founder of the Monastery of the Deep Stream, Cappadocia (10th c.)
- Saint Leo the Hermit, Ascetic.
